Draft: Add design for periodic workflows
Split out from !1086 (merged). It turns out we don't need this in that design, but I think something like this is still useful so I didn't want to lose it.
Split out from !1086 (merged). It turns out we don't need this in that design, but I think something like this is still useful so I didn't want to lose it.